24 Best Search Engines in the World [2024 List]

When it comes to search engines, most people think of Google. However, there are several other search engines that offer unique features and cater to specific needs. In this article, we will explore the top search engines in 2024, providing you with a comprehensive list to enhance your search experience.

1. Google

Let’s start with the obvious choice. Google continues to dominate the search engine market with its powerful algorithms and vast index of web pages. It offers a user-friendly interface and provides accurate and relevant search results. Google also offers various services like Google Maps, Google Images, and Google News, making it a one-stop solution for all your search needs.

2. Bing

Bing is Microsoft’s search engine and is known for its visually appealing homepage images. It provides a seamless search experience and offers features like video previews, image search, and news integration. Bing also powers Yahoo’s search engine, making it the second most popular search engine globally.

3. Yahoo

Yahoo, once a dominant player in the search engine market, now relies on Bing for its search results. However, Yahoo still offers a unique search experience with its news integration, email, and other services. It is a popular choice for users who prefer a familiar interface and personalized content.

4. Baidu

Baidu is the leading search engine in China and is often referred to as the “Google of China.” It caters to the Chinese language and offers services like maps, news, and multimedia content. Baidu’s strong presence in the Chinese market makes it a crucial search engine for businesses targeting the Chinese audience.

5. Yandex

Yandex is the most popular search engine in Russia and is known for its advanced language processing capabilities. It offers a range of services like maps, images, and news, along with a user-friendly interface. Yandex also provides a unique feature called “Spectrum,” which displays related search queries to help users refine their search.

6. DuckDuckGo

If privacy is your top concern, DuckDuckGo is the search engine for you. It emphasizes user privacy by not tracking or storing personal information. DuckDuckGo also offers a clean interface and provides search results from various sources, ensuring unbiased and uncensored information.

7. Ask

Ask.com, formerly known as Ask Jeeves, is a question-answering search engine. It allows users to ask questions in natural language and provides relevant answers. Ask.com also offers a range of services like weather forecasts, news, and image search.

8. AOL

AOL is a popular search engine that provides a simple and straightforward search experience. It offers a variety of services like email, news, and entertainment. AOL also has a vast directory of websites, making it easy to find specific information.

9. Ecosia

Ecosia is a unique search engine that focuses on sustainability. It uses its ad revenue to plant trees and supports various environmental projects. Ecosia offers a clean interface and provides search results powered by Bing.

10. Startpage

Startpage is another privacy-focused search engine that prioritizes user anonymity. It acts as a proxy between the user and the search engine, ensuring that personal information is not shared. Startpage also offers search results from Google, providing accurate and relevant information.

11. Dogpile

Dogpile is a metasearch engine that fetches results from multiple search engines and displays them in one place. It saves time by eliminating the need to visit multiple search engines individually. Dogpile also offers features like image search and video search.

12. WolframAlpha

WolframAlpha is a computational search engine that provides answers to factual queries. It uses a vast collection of curated data to generate accurate and detailed results. WolframAlpha is particularly useful for students, researchers, and professionals.

13. Swisscows

Swisscows is a privacy-focused search engine that does not store any personal information. It offers a family-friendly search experience by filtering out explicit content. Swisscows also provides semantic search capabilities, ensuring more accurate search results.

14. Qwant

Qwant is a European search engine that emphasizes user privacy and data protection. It does not track or profile users, ensuring a private search experience. Qwant also offers features like news, maps, and social media search.

15. Gibiru

Gibiru is a search engine that claims to provide uncensored and unbiased search results. It focuses on privacy and does not track or filter search queries. Gibiru also offers a unique feature called “Uncensored News,” which displays news articles from alternative sources.

16. Boardreader

Boardreader is a search engine specifically designed for forums and message boards. It allows users to search for discussions and threads on various topics. Boardreader is a valuable tool for finding information and opinions from online communities.

17. Ekoru

Ekoru is an eco-friendly search engine that donates 60% of its revenue to ocean conservation projects. It offers a clean and minimalist interface and provides search results powered by Bing. Ekoru also displays the amount of CO2 saved with each search.

18. Disconnect Search

Disconnect Search is a privacy-focused search engine that prevents search engines from tracking user activity. It acts as a middleman between the user and the search engine, ensuring anonymity. Disconnect Search also offers a feature called “Private Browsing,” which blocks third-party trackers.

19. OneSearch

OneSearch is Verizon’s privacy-focused search engine that does not store personal information or search history. It offers a clean interface and provides search results powered by Bing. OneSearch also provides additional privacy features like expiring search history and encrypted search results.
